
ZenaDrone, Inc. (a subsidiary company of Epazz Holdings) has executed the SBIR award contract that focused on ZenaDrone’s flagship drone, the ZenaDrone 1000 technology, to address the most pressing challenges in the Department of the Air Force (DAF).
The ZenaDrone 1000 is multi-purpose technology that can be used for both military and civilian applications. It is designed to be a reliable and cost-effective solution for the US Air Force and other defense departments. The drone is equipped with advanced sensors and cameras that can be used to detect and identify objects in the air, on the ground, and in the water. It also has the capability to detect and track moving targets, as well as provide real-time situational awareness.
The ZenaDrone 1000 is also designed to be a reliable and cost-effective solution for civilian applications. It can be used for search and rescue operations, surveillance, and mapping. It can also be used for agricultural applications, such as crop monitoring and precision agriculture.
